HP laptop users report loud fan noise and receive the System Fan (90b) error code. This error is related to your system fan and signals a heating system problem. This problem normally occurs when the computer is turned on, and the system fan begins to spin faster.

If you’re having difficulties with this error, here’s how to easily solve HP laptop error code 90b.

How do I fix the cooling system on my HP laptop?

1. Update BIOS

    1. The first thing you should do is check your laptop for any outstanding BIOS updates. The most recent BIOS update for your machine can be found on the HP website.
    2. Download HP Support Assistant software from the HP Support Assistant page here. If necessary, install the software.
    3. Start the program, go to the My Devices page, identify your computer, and click Updates.
    4. To obtain the most recent updates, go to “Check for updates and notifications.”
    5. Check the BIOS update box and select Download and Install if any updates are found.
    6. Once the update has been installed, close the Support Assistant. Restart the computer and see if anything has changed.

2. Clean the Air Vents and CPU Fans

    1. If the problem persists, it’s possible that dust has accumulated in the laptop’s outside vents, causing a temperature rise and, as a result, the mistake. It could also happen if your CPU’s thermal paste has dried out and needs replacement.
    2. Check the outside vents after shutting down the computer and blow air through the open vents to eliminate any dust buildup.
    3. Also, carefully clean the CPU fans before replacing the lid. Check for a resolution after restarting the computer.
    4. Check if the CPU thermal paste has dried out if the problem persists. Remove any residual thermal paste and reapply the new thermal paste. If you’re not sure how to accomplish it, get an expert.
    5. Check to see whether the error reappears after restarting the computer. Because the error is usually caused by a lack of heat, cleaning the air vents and reapplying the thermal paste should fix the problem.

3. Perform Hard Reset

    1. If the problem persists, try doing a hard reset. This will just reset the thermal values, allowing you to operate the system without error once more.
    2. Turn off the HP laptop to do a hard reset.
    3. Disconnect any external devices from your laptop. If the power cord is connected in, unplug it as well.
    4. To reset your laptop, press and hold the power button for 15 seconds. Take a break from your laptop for a minute or two.
    5. Now connect the power adapter to the wall outlet and the laptop to the power cord.
    6. Turn on the computer and see if there are any improvements.

User Questions

1. Why isn’t the fan on my HP laptop working?

Ensure that all internal cooling components are free of dust. Ensure that the system and CPU fans’ wires are firmly connected to the motherboard. Check that the fan blades on the system are spinning properly and that the fan is not making any loud noises. Replace the system fan if it isn’t working properly.

2. How can I repair my laptop’s cooling fan?

Examine the computer’s air vents for dust or dirt. The air vents may be placed in various locations depending on the computer model. Consult your Dell computer’s user manual. Remove any dust or debris from the air vents, dust filters (if any), and cooling fan fins with a can of pressurized air.

3. How can I go into the BIOS on an HP laptop?

To access the BIOS Setup Utility, press f10. After turning on the computer, continually press the esc key until the Startup Menu appears. To get the BIOS revision (version) and date, go to the File tab, use the down arrow to select System Information, and then press enter.
